oparu from Boston, MA, Rating:3.0I bought these for riding my scooter in cool weather. These would be good if the gloves could fit over my coat or jacket sleeves. The battery packs are a little bulky to pull my sleeves over them. Also, it's weird to have to use 4 AA batteries in each glove. That could get expensive if you don't use rechargeable batteries. The heat is actually not very intense. So, they're only good if you're doing something active and not just using them in very cold weather to stand around outside.
